Lottie is taking part in the Walk 50K This May challenge for Sweet Louise, in memory of her beautiful mum, Laura.
“My mum had the nicest smile,” says Lottie.
“I know that Sweet Louise helped my mum smile. I have some photos of my mum smiling at Sweet Louise events. I love those photos.”

Lottie’s dad, Brad, shares:
“When Laura was diagnosed with incurable breast cancer, our world changed overnight. Lottie and her sister were so little. Suddenly, Laura was managing ongoing appointments, treatment plans, and side effects — alongside all the things no one prepares you for. The fear, the exhaustion, and the pressure of trying to keep life moving with little ones while everything feels uncertain.
Sweet Louise was there for Laura when she needed it most. A Sweet Louise Support Coordinator checked in regularly and explained things clearly. Coffee catch-ups and connection with a community made Laura feel less alone. Practical help, like grocery vouchers, supported our family when finances were tight.
Lottie thinks about her mum every day and wants to do all she can to help others have a big smile like hers, which is why she decided to take part in Walk 50K This May. We’ve walked to school instead of driving, our friends and family have rallied to take Lottie on extra walks, and she even completed a mud run this year to keep things fun!
Sweet Louise helped Laura through her toughest days. Giving back to the people who supported us through our hardest time is really important to me — a way of passing it on. Lottie may not fully understand it yet, but she knows Sweet Louise was there for her mum when she needed it most. We both want to make sure Sweet Louise is there for everyone facing their hardest days.
